Rechartering

Renew Your Charter Online


A representative of each unit can now renew their charter online. From Internet Rechartering, you can indicate returning members, add new members, and update information for an individual or the chartered organization. It is easier and faster to do rechartering on line.

How to Use

Get Trained to use on line rechartering: District November Roundtables will feature training on Internet Rechartering.

Each unit must select an adult to be its renewal processor; this adult must attend the training. Additionally, anyone who wants to learn more about how Internet Rechartering works can take the interactive Internet Rechartering tutorial and view the help.  

To renew a charter online:

  1. Select someone to be the renewal processor for you unit by October 30th
  2. The renewal processor attends the November Roundtable to receive training and the unit access code.
  3. Thirty 30 days before the unit's expiration date, the renewal processor clicks Recharter Now and begins the process.
  4. When the online process is completed, the renewal processor prints the completed charter renewal application.
  5. The unit leader and the chartered organization representative sign the charter renewal application. Bring the application along with the material you received in your recharter packet (such as the Quality Unit application), and all appropriate fees to your district's charter turn-in meeting, or to the Scout Office.
